As a bodybuilder, building a strong image is vital to establishing a successful career in the fitness industry. Just like a personal trainer builds a client's physique through regular exercises, you need to work on building your own personal brand to increase your credibility.
In this article, we will discuss the importance of building a personal brand as a bodybuilder and provide tips on how to do it properly.
So, what's the point of building a personal brand so important for bodybuilders? The main reason is that it helps you stand out from the crowd. With the rise of social media, the fitness industry has become increasingly saturated with other personal trainers, Yahoo Musclemeccaa all vying for attention. A strong personal brand sets you apart from the competition and gives you a unique identity that resonates with your target fans.
Having a personal brand also opens up opportunities for affiliated workout programs, supplement partnerships, and other business ventures that can help you earn a significant income. It can also lead to speaking engagements, coaching, and modeling gigs, which can further boost your income and profile.
Now that we've covered the importance of building a personal brand, let's move on to some tips on how to do it effectively.
First and foremost, you need to define your unique selling proposition (USP). This is something that sets you apart from other bodybuilders and helps you establish your niche. For example, you might specialize in natural bodybuilding, focus on wellness coaching, or concentrate on body composition. Whatever your USP is, you need to own it and showcase it regularly across all your marketing channels.
Next, you need to develop a consistent visual identity. This includes creating a branding element, choosing a branding palette, and selecting a font that reflects your brand's tone. Consistency is key to building a strong brand, so make sure that your visual identity is used consistently across all your social media platforms, website, and marketing materials.
Social media is a crucial component of building a personal brand, and as a bodybuilder, you need to be active on platforms like Instagram, LinkedIn. Share high-quality content that showcases your physique, workouts, and nutritional routines, and engage with your followers by responding to messages. Consistency is key, so aim to post at least three times a week and engage with your followers daily.
You also need to develop content marketing skills to attract and retain a clearly defined audience. Create informative articles, videos, and podcasts that offer useful information on fitness, nutrition, and bodybuilding. Share your expertise, and make sure that your content is informative.
Networking is another vital aspect of building a personal brand. Attend industry events, join online communities and forums, and connect with other experts in the fitness industry. Collaborate with other bodybuilders, trainers, and coaches to create content, host webinars, or launch new programs.
Finally, authenticity is key to building a strong personal brand. Be true to yourself, and don't pretend to be someone you're not. Share your failures, and use them as opportunities to learn and grow. Remember, your personal brand is a reflection of who you are as a person, so make sure that it's true.
In conclusion, building a personal brand as a bodybuilder is essential to establishing a successful career in the fitness industry. By defining your USP, developing a consistent visual identity, leveraging social media, creating content, networking, and being authentic, you can establish a strong personal brand that sets you apart from the competition and opens up opportunities for new business ventures and revenue streams.
